2017-01-21 3 views
-2

Ich dachte Maven war eine Möglichkeit, ein Projekt zu bauen, ohne auf Ihre IDE angewiesen zu sein. Ich habe Anweisungen befolgt, die meine IDE betreffen, nur um zu finden, dass das Projekt nur innerhalb der IDE funktioniert.Maven ohne die Maus

Ich benutze intellij, aber ich wünschte, ich hätte dir das nicht einmal sagen müssen. Bin ich falsch oder gibt es eine Möglichkeit, ein Maven-Projekt mit Tastenanschlägen zu bauen nicht "klick das, dann das" Maus Anweisungen, die Lord weiß, was in der IDE. Ein Weg, der innerhalb einer IDE funktioniert, aber nicht von dieser IDE abhängig ist?

Ich hoffe, dass ich einige Anweisungen befolgt habe, die das einfach nicht als Ziel hatten. Gibt es eine Möglichkeit, ein Maven-Projekt zu erstellen, das intellij genauso gut funktioniert wie Eclipse? Wenn ja, wie finde ich es? Gibt es ein Keyword, nach dem ich suchen muss?

Ich bin wahrscheinlich etwas falsch verstehen, aber ich hoffe, ich habe mein Ziel gemacht, mein Projekt nur auf Maven selbst klar zu machen.

+1

Maven ist ein Befehlszeilentool. IDEs bieten Maven-Integration. Ich bin mir nicht einmal sicher, was das Problem ist - die Maven-Dokumentation sagt Ihnen konkret, wie Sie es von Ihrer Shell aus starten: http://maven.apache.org/run.html –

+0

Verwenden der Befehlszeile oder Shell unter Linux. .will den Trick ... – khmarbaise

+0

Zu meinem Entsetzen finde ich Dinge wie "effektive Pom anzeigen", die mir eine generierte Pom-Datei zeigt, die ich nicht bearbeiten kann. - Sie sollten das effektive POM nicht bearbeiten können. Es ist eine abgeleitete "Datei", die von Ihrem tatsächlichen Pom und allen Eltern stammt. Dies ist kein IDE-Problem. –

Antwort

1

Sie können ein Maven-Projekt aus seinem Verzeichnis mit bauen -

mvn clean install 

Natürlich erfordert dies Maven auf dem Rechner installiert Sie es aus ausgeführt werden.

Bitte beachten Sie auch die Dokumentation here.

+0

Du hast gerade genau das bewiesen, wovor ich Angst hatte. Das Ausführen dieses Befehls zeigt Fehler, die die IDE nicht hatte. Ich schätze, ich kann einfach keine IDE verwenden, um ein Maven-Projekt zu erstellen. – CandiedOrange

+0

@CandiedOrange müssen Sie klarstellen, was Sie erreichen wollen und wovor Sie stehen. Bitte mach das in der Frage selbst dann. IMO-Folgefehler, falls vorhanden, sollten weiter debuggt und gelöst werden und nicht mit demselben Thread in Beziehung stehen. – nullpointer

+0

Ich bin mit einer Unmenge an Online-Dokumentation konfrontiert, die mir erklärt, wie man Maven in meiner IDE und Projekte in meiner IDE einrichtet, die bei der Erstellung ein Maven-Projekt ergeben, das nur in meiner IDE funktioniert. Ich suche nach Anweisungen, die zeigen, wie man das vermeidet. Ihre Antwort bestand darin, die IDE einfach nicht zum Erstellen zu verwenden. Was könnte die einzige gute Antwort sein. – CandiedOrange

Verwandte Themen